RecStripper - TAP zum Schrumpfen der Aufnahmen

TAPs für die SRP- und CRP-Serie
chris86
Moderator
Moderator
Beiträge: 1171
Registriert: Sa 4. Jun 2011, 22:35
Receivertyp: 2x SRP-2410, CRP-2401CI+
Receiverfirmware: SRP: 2011Sep29 / 2013Jan10 (RC) / 2013Dez19
CRP: 2013Feb05
Kontaktdaten:

Re: RecStripper - TAP zum Schrumpfen der Aufnahmen

#601

Beitrag von chris86 » Mo 20. Jul 2020, 11:52

Der Topf hat einfach eine ziemlich schwache CPU!
Am PC ist der Unterschied weitaus geringer...

Aber zuerst müssen die genannten Bugs raus, dann kann man optimieren.

Benutzeravatar
Alter Sack
Alt-Guru
Alt-Guru
Beiträge: 10631
Registriert: Do 8. Dez 2005, 22:35
Receivertyp: diverse
Wohnort: NRW - GM

Re: RecStripper - TAP zum Schrumpfen der Aufnahmen

#602

Beitrag von Alter Sack » Di 21. Jul 2020, 10:44

chris86 hat geschrieben:
Do 9. Jul 2020, 20:47
(Vorerst) bleibt es bei der bekannten Einschränkung:
chris86 hat geschrieben:
Fr 10. Apr 2020, 17:56
Die neue Version setzt voraus, dass der PCR auf der Video-PID übertragen wird. (Eine Anpassung für separate PCR-PID wäre theoretisch möglich, aber recht aufwändig, und mir ist noch keine Test-Aufnahme untergekommen, wo das der Fall wäre. Wenn jemand eine findet, kann ich versuchen, das umzusetzen.)
Dies trifft aber auf alle mir bekannten Sender zu. Sollte jemand einen Sender finden, bei dem dies nicht so ist, dann schickt mir gerne ein Test-Sample zu, damit ich diesen Fall behandeln kann!
Wenn man die Sender in Excel vergleicht, wird man schnell fündig, ob du da aber Arbeit reinstecken willst :thinker:
Da wäre z.B. Aragon TV INT, CNBC Europe, Nick Jr. von Sky und etliche Ruf-Mich-An-Sender.

Hier zwei Logs dazu:

Code: Alles auswählen

2020-07-21 10:23:25 ***  RecStripper v0.6 started! (FBLib 2013-02-24+) ***
2020-07-21 10:23:25 =======================================================
2020-07-21 10:23:25 Receiver Model: SRP-2401CI+ (22120), System Type: TMS-S (5)
2020-07-21 10:23:25 Firmware: TF-BCPCE 1.14.00
2020-07-21 10:23:25 RecStripDir: /mnt/hd/DataFiles/RecStrip, OutDir: /mnt/hd/DataFiles/RecStrip_out
2020-07-21 10:23:25 Nr of files and folders: 1
2020-07-21 10:23:28 Processing file 'Nick Jr.rec' (34272192 bytes)... 
2020-07-21 10:23:28 RecStrip finished.
2020-07-21 10:23:28 RecStrip returned error code 4! Elapsed time: 0 s.
2020-07-21 10:23:28 0 of 1 files successfully processed.
2020-07-21 10:23:30 RecStripper Exit.

2020-07-21 10:26:45 ***  RecStripper v0.6 started! (FBLib 2013-02-24+) ***
2020-07-21 10:26:45 =======================================================
2020-07-21 10:26:45 Receiver Model: SRP-2401CI+ (22120), System Type: TMS-S (5)
2020-07-21 10:26:45 Firmware: TF-BCPCE 1.14.00
2020-07-21 10:26:45 RecStripDir: /mnt/hd/DataFiles/RecStrip, OutDir: /mnt/hd/DataFiles/RecStrip_out
2020-07-21 10:26:45 Nr of files and folders: 2
2020-07-21 10:26:47 Processing file 'Aragon TV.rec' (20053120 bytes)... 
2020-07-21 10:26:48 RecStrip finished.
2020-07-21 10:26:48 RecStrip returned error code 4! Elapsed time: 1 s.
2020-07-21 10:26:48 Processing file 'Nick Jr.rec' (34272192 bytes)... 
2020-07-21 10:26:48 RecStrip finished.
2020-07-21 10:26:48 RecStrip returned error code 4! Elapsed time: 0 s.
2020-07-21 10:26:48 0 of 2 files successfully processed.
2020-07-21 10:26:53 RecStripper Exit.

Code: Alles auswählen

RecStrip for Topfield PVR v3.0
(C) 2016-2020 Christian Wuensch
- based on Naludump 0.1.1 by Udo Richter -
- based on MovieCutter 3.6 -
- portions of Mpeg2cleaner (S. Poeschel), RebuildNav (Firebird) & TFTool (jkIT)

Parameters:
DoCut=0, DoMerge=0, DoStrip=yes, RmEPG=yes, RmTxt=no, RmScr=no, RbldNav=no, RbldInf=no, PkSize=0

Input file: /mnt/hd/DataFiles/RecStrip/Aragon TV.rec
  File size: 20053120, packet size: 192
  TS: PMTPID=1032, SID=29811, PCRPID=5172, Stream=0x2, VPID=172, HD=0
  TS: SvcName   = ARAGON TV INT
  Failed to get the EIT information.
  Duration calculation failed (missing PCR). Using 120 minutes.
  TS: FirstPCR  = 0 (0:00:00,000), Last: 0 (0:00:00,000)
  TS: Duration  = 120 min 00 sec
  TS: StartTime = Tue 21 Jul 2020 10:24:00
  PIDs to be checked for continuity: [0] [172], [1] 128, [2] 18

Inf file: /mnt/hd/DataFiles/RecStrip/Aragon TV.rec.inf
  Determine SystemType: DVBs = -1, DVBt = -3, DVBc = -3 Points
   -> SystemType=ST_TMSs
  INF: VideoStream=0x2, VideoPID=172, HD=0
  ASSERTION: PCR-PID (5172) differs from VideoPID (172). Stripping aborted.

ERROR: Cannot open input /mnt/hd/DataFiles/RecStrip/Aragon TV.rec.

RecStrip for Topfield PVR v3.0
(C) 2016-2020 Christian Wuensch
- based on Naludump 0.1.1 by Udo Richter -
- based on MovieCutter 3.6 -
- portions of Mpeg2cleaner (S. Poeschel), RebuildNav (Firebird) & TFTool (jkIT)

Parameters:
DoCut=0, DoMerge=0, DoStrip=yes, RmEPG=yes, RmTxt=no, RmScr=no, RbldNav=no, RbldInf=no, PkSize=0

Input file: /mnt/hd/DataFiles/RecStrip/Nick Jr.rec
  File size: 34272192, packet size: 192
  TS: PMTPID=327, SID=28667, PCRPID=8189, Stream=0x2, VPID=3111, HD=0
  TS: EvtStart  = Tue 21 Jul 2020 08:10:00 (UTC)
  TS: EventName = 
  TS: EventDesc = 
  TS: ExtEvent  = 
  TS: SvcName   = Nick.Jr.
  TS: EvtStart  = Tue 21 Jul 2020 08:10:00 (GMT+0)
  TS: FirstPCR  = 2509411316238 (25:49:01,159), Last: 2511056569816 (25:50:02,095)
  TS: Duration  = 01 min 00 sec
  TS: StartTime = Tue 21 Jul 2020 10:14:01
  PIDs to be checked for continuity: [0] [3111], [1] 3112, [2] 3113, [3] 18

Inf file: /mnt/hd/DataFiles/RecStrip/Nick Jr.rec.inf
  Determine SystemType: DVBs = -1, DVBt = -3, DVBc = -3 Points
   -> SystemType=ST_TMSs
  INF: VideoStream=0x2, VideoPID=3111, HD=0
  ASSERTION: PCR-PID (8189) differs from VideoPID (3111). Stripping aborted.

ERROR: Cannot open input /mnt/hd/DataFiles/RecStrip/Nick Jr.rec.
Zuletzt geändert von Alter Sack am Di 21. Jul 2020, 11:57, insgesamt 1-mal geändert.
Aktive Receiver:
3x SRP2401CI+
Stille Reserve:
3x SRP2401CI+, 2x SRP2401CI+ECO, 2x SRP2100, TF7700HDPVR, TF7700HSCI, TF5500PVR

Benutzeravatar
Alter Sack
Alt-Guru
Alt-Guru
Beiträge: 10631
Registriert: Do 8. Dez 2005, 22:35
Receivertyp: diverse
Wohnort: NRW - GM

Re: RecStripper - TAP zum Schrumpfen der Aufnahmen

#603

Beitrag von Alter Sack » Di 21. Jul 2020, 11:33

Das betrifft natürlich auch alle Radio-Aufnahmen, die sich mit 2.6 noch Strippen lassen, mit 3.0 aber nicht.
Aktive Receiver:
3x SRP2401CI+
Stille Reserve:
3x SRP2401CI+, 2x SRP2401CI+ECO, 2x SRP2100, TF7700HDPVR, TF7700HSCI, TF5500PVR

chris86
Moderator
Moderator
Beiträge: 1171
Registriert: Sa 4. Jun 2011, 22:35
Receivertyp: 2x SRP-2410, CRP-2401CI+
Receiverfirmware: SRP: 2011Sep29 / 2013Jan10 (RC) / 2013Dez19
CRP: 2013Feb05
Kontaktdaten:

Re: RecStripper - TAP zum Schrumpfen der Aufnahmen

#604

Beitrag von chris86 » Mi 22. Jul 2020, 18:13

Alter Sack hat geschrieben:
Di 21. Jul 2020, 10:44
Wenn man die Sender in Excel vergleicht, wird man schnell fündig, ob du da aber Arbeit reinstecken willst :thinker:
Da wäre z.B. Aragon TV INT, CNBC Europe, Nick Jr. von Sky und etliche Ruf-Mich-An-Sender.
Vielen Dank für den Hinweis!! :up:
Auf diese Idee bin ich tatsächlich nicht gekommen! :patsch:
Aber ganz ehrlich - Sky habe ich nicht, und wenn es wirklich nur die Anruf-Senderchen sind, dann lohnt sich der Aufwand dafür jetzt echt nicht!
Zumal dann ja auch der Algorithmus wieder aufwändiger würde, und somit tendenziell eher noch langsamer...

Das mit den Radio-Aufnahmen ist aber ein guter Hinweis!
Da wäre die Einschränkung eigentlich nicht notwendig. Das schaue ich mir an.

Benutzeravatar
Homer
ToppiHolic gefährdet
ToppiHolic gefährdet
Beiträge: 9728
Registriert: Sa 11. Mär 2006, 12:08
Receivertyp: TF5200PVRc (seit 25. März 2006) CRP-2401CI+ (seit 26. Mai 2011) Uno 4K
Receiverfirmware: Dec 06 2006,
Mar 9 2011
Wohnort: 669..
Kontaktdaten:

Re: RecStripper - TAP zum Schrumpfen der Aufnahmen

#605

Beitrag von Homer » Mi 22. Jul 2020, 20:42

chris86 hat geschrieben:
Mi 22. Jul 2020, 18:13
Das mit den Radio-Aufnahmen ist aber ein guter Hinweis!
Da wäre die Einschränkung eigentlich nicht notwendig. Das schaue ich mir an.
Radiosender mit zwei Audiospuren (Klassikwellen der ÖR) haben auf jeder dieser PIDs PCR-Infos.

Viele Grüße
Homer
rettet-das-freetv.de Project Euler 2401 Urban Priol ist ein smarter Androide und kann keine TAPs.

TF5200PVRc (HA250JC)
TAPs: BootMenu - UsbAccelerator - [thread=49960]acaderc_5k[/thread] - RemoteSwitch - Automove V1.9 final [90] (18.04.2008) - TF5000Display - 3PG - IdleHDD

CRP-2401CI+ (ST3500312CS,MZ-75E500B)
TAPs: XStartTap_TMS - AutoReboot - RemoteSwitch_TMS - RescueRecs - SmartEPG_TMS - RebuildNAV - Automove V2.0 beta 13 (24.05.2011) - StartFTPd - TMSRemote - NiceDisplay

KabelBW Unitymedia (free to air)

chris86
Moderator
Moderator
Beiträge: 1171
Registriert: Sa 4. Jun 2011, 22:35
Receivertyp: 2x SRP-2410, CRP-2401CI+
Receiverfirmware: SRP: 2011Sep29 / 2013Jan10 (RC) / 2013Dez19
CRP: 2013Feb05
Kontaktdaten:

Re: RecStripper - TAP zum Schrumpfen der Aufnahmen

#606

Beitrag von chris86 » Sa 1. Aug 2020, 14:39

Ein weiterer Bug in RecStrip 3 wurde behoben (wieder Danke an wtuppa :hello:)!
Im Falle von TS-Paketen, welche als Payload_Unit_Start markiert sind, jedoch den Startcode nicht am Anfang des Pakets aufweisen, erfolgte ein fehlerhafter Speicherzugriff, der im schlimmsten Fall zum Abbruch des Programms (Segmentation Fault) führen konnte.

Zur Behebung:
Einfach MovieCutter 3.6f über TAPtoDate neu installieren, oder die neuen Binaries aus dem aktualisierten RecStrip Downloadarchiv verwenden.

Achja: Auch das Strippen von Radio-Aufnahmen sollte jetzt wieder wie früher funktionieren.

(RecStrip 2.x ist - trotz gleichem Code an der fraglichen Stelle - nicht von dem Bug betroffen. Hier wurden jedoch noch unwesentliche Änderungen bei der Ermittlung der Startzeit vorgenommen.)

Benutzeravatar
Twilight
Zauberküchencheflehrling mit extra Butter
Zauberküchencheflehrling mit extra Butter
Beiträge: 64886
Registriert: Fr 9. Dez 2005, 09:17
Receivertyp: 1 x SRP 2100(TMS) TFIR und .1 x SRP 2410 M
Wohnort: Wien Umgebung

Re: RecStripper - TAP zum Schrumpfen der Aufnahmen

#607

Beitrag von Twilight » So 2. Aug 2020, 14:13

toll wie du das machst chris!! :respekt:

twilight

Benutzeravatar
db1
Topfmeister
Topfmeister
Beiträge: 746
Registriert: Di 13. Dez 2005, 00:22
Receivertyp: SRP-2100, TF4000PVR
Receiverfirmware: ORF "Testversion"
Wohnort: nähe Wien

Re: RecStripper - TAP zum Schrumpfen der Aufnahmen

#608

Beitrag von db1 » So 15. Nov 2020, 19:13

Muss man eigentlich davon ausgehen, dass die gestrippten files corrupt sind, wenn solche Fehlermeldungen auftreten (ORF Aufnahme, Windows Version von 3.6fbeta):

Code: Alles auswählen

cNaluDumper: Unexpected end of filler NALU at packet end (pos of PES: 8726133504)

chris86
Moderator
Moderator
Beiträge: 1171
Registriert: Sa 4. Jun 2011, 22:35
Receivertyp: 2x SRP-2410, CRP-2401CI+
Receiverfirmware: SRP: 2011Sep29 / 2013Jan10 (RC) / 2013Dez19
CRP: 2013Feb05
Kontaktdaten:

Re: RecStripper - TAP zum Schrumpfen der Aufnahmen

#609

Beitrag von chris86 » Mo 16. Nov 2020, 00:56

Kurze Antwort: Nein.

Lange Antwort: Normalerweise sollten Filler-NALUs mit einer bestimmten End-Sequenz abgeschlossen werden. Es gibt aber Sender, welche diese End-Sequenz regelmäßig weglassen, wenn danach eine neue NALU startet. Gerade wenn diese Meldung bei einer Aufnahme häufiger auftaucht, dann ist es wohl ein solcher Sender, und damit als "normal" anzusehen. Taucht die Meldung bei einer Aufnahme nur 1-2x auf, dann ist es möglich, dass an dieser Stelle ein Übertragungsfehler (Signalstörung) vorlag. Dann ist das gestrippte File aber nicht "korrupter" als das Original.

Benutzeravatar
db1
Topfmeister
Topfmeister
Beiträge: 746
Registriert: Di 13. Dez 2005, 00:22
Receivertyp: SRP-2100, TF4000PVR
Receiverfirmware: ORF "Testversion"
Wohnort: nähe Wien

Re: RecStripper - TAP zum Schrumpfen der Aufnahmen

#610

Beitrag von db1 » Mo 16. Nov 2020, 08:01

Danke für die Antwort und deine unermüdliche Arbeit :bier:

Benutzeravatar
Homer
ToppiHolic gefährdet
ToppiHolic gefährdet
Beiträge: 9728
Registriert: Sa 11. Mär 2006, 12:08
Receivertyp: TF5200PVRc (seit 25. März 2006) CRP-2401CI+ (seit 26. Mai 2011) Uno 4K
Receiverfirmware: Dec 06 2006,
Mar 9 2011
Wohnort: 669..
Kontaktdaten:

Re: RecStripper - TAP zum Schrumpfen der Aufnahmen

#611

Beitrag von Homer » Sa 20. Feb 2021, 17:25

chris86 hat geschrieben:
Fr 10. Apr 2020, 17:56
bekannte Einschränkungen:
  • Die neue Version setzt voraus, dass der PCR auf der Video-PID übertragen wird.
Ich weiß nicht, ob du es schon wusstest: In der PMT gibt es das Feld PCR_PID.
ISO/IEC 13818-1 Second edition 2000-12-01 hat geschrieben:PCR_PID – This is a 13-bit field indicating the PID of the Transport Stream packets which shall contain the PCR fields valid for the program specified by program_number. If no PCR is associated with a program definition for private streams, then this field shall take the value of 0x1FFF.
Viele Grüße
Homer
rettet-das-freetv.de Project Euler 2401 Urban Priol ist ein smarter Androide und kann keine TAPs.

TF5200PVRc (HA250JC)
TAPs: BootMenu - UsbAccelerator - [thread=49960]acaderc_5k[/thread] - RemoteSwitch - Automove V1.9 final [90] (18.04.2008) - TF5000Display - 3PG - IdleHDD

CRP-2401CI+ (ST3500312CS,MZ-75E500B)
TAPs: XStartTap_TMS - AutoReboot - RemoteSwitch_TMS - RescueRecs - SmartEPG_TMS - RebuildNAV - Automove V2.0 beta 13 (24.05.2011) - StartFTPd - TMSRemote - NiceDisplay

KabelBW Unitymedia (free to air)

chris86
Moderator
Moderator
Beiträge: 1171
Registriert: Sa 4. Jun 2011, 22:35
Receivertyp: 2x SRP-2410, CRP-2401CI+
Receiverfirmware: SRP: 2011Sep29 / 2013Jan10 (RC) / 2013Dez19
CRP: 2013Feb05
Kontaktdaten:

Re: RecStripper - TAP zum Schrumpfen der Aufnahmen

#612

Beitrag von chris86 » Sa 20. Feb 2021, 18:23

Vielen Dank für den Hinweis! :up:
Tatsächlich weiß ich das bereits. Der Grund für die Einschränkung liegt aber woanders.

Antworten

Zurück zu „SRP/CRP TAP-Bereich“